You can get the Isopure clear at GNC or Vitamin Shoppe. They have many different flavors. I like the apple melon the best. Another thing I just tried are called: New whey liquid Protein. They are sold at Walmart in the fitness/diet area (near the pharmacy). They are in oversized white test tube looking things - 42 grams of protein - its only 3.8 oz, but its kinda thick, so I dilute it in a bottle of Water. Again, more like a weird Gatorade type drink. I just couldn't drink anymore choc shakes and these 2 things have really helped.

I felt weird about telling some of my work teammates too. I started with telling my boss because I had to be off work for appts and she (who is a twig) was actually very understanding and supportive. Right before I took off for the surgery, I told my teammates in an email. I told them I felt like this was the right thing to do for me and my future and I hoped I had their support, and I didnt really want it to spread much further, so I asked that they please keep my news within the team. So far, even the ones Im not close to have been very supportive. You will be amazed! Good luck!- Be honest - does anyone regret the surgery?
